Summary
This staff report is about a matter which Community Council has delegated authority from City Council to make a final decision.
Transportation Services has assessed an appeal for Commercial Boulevard Parking (CBP) from the owner of 170 Bedford Road. Commercial boulevard parking at this location is not recommended because on-street metered parking is in effect along the street fronting the proposed parking stalls. The regulations of the City of Toronto Municipal Code Chapter 743 do not permit CBP due to the installation of ramp to access the parking stalls will be contrary to municipal purpose due to loss of revenue from Toronto Parking Authority (TPA). The owner will be given an opportunity to make a deputation before Community Council.
